Scott Sanderson had an impressive outing as the Sacramento Red Sox topped the
Chicago Fire by a score of 6 to 0 at Comiskey Park.
Sanderson(1-0) was virtually untouchable. He was stingy on the mound,
allowing just 2 hits and 3 walks in 8 innings. For the game Sacramento
out-hit Chicago 9 to 2.
Pete Vuckovich(2-2) suffered the loss. He pitched 5 innings and surrendered 6
hits and 3 walks.
